Alert: HealthGate has detected that more than 30% of backend instances behind the Corvid load balancer are failing their readiness probes. Traffic is being concentrated on remaining healthy nodes, which may cause elevated latency. This often follows a deploy where the new build fails startup checks; confirm whether a rollout is in progress before taking action. Rollback is safe and automated. Thresholds, probe configuration, and the full response procedure are documented on the internal page:

dashboard of kafof-tahaf = https://confluence.tolvaqsys.internal/projects/browse/display/a1250987

Ticket: DeployBot env misconfig on Harrowgate staging.

The deploy-status chat bot posts to the wrong room because staging copied prod's channel map. Reviewer: check the diff only touches the staging overlay. Channel routing is fixed in this patch; bot auth was never set at all, which is why it silently dropped messages. The bot's messaging credential goes on the line below.

secret setting of kajep-tagep: VAULT_KEY5=e66ae

Fan-out backpressure for the Quillet notifier: when the queue depth crosses the soft limit, the dispatcher sheds low-priority pushes and batches the rest at 500ms intervals. Reviewer should confirm the shed counter is exported and that retries respect the jitter window. Once merged, the release artifact gets re-signed by the pipeline, which expects the deploy key shown below.

deploy key for bawep-yawif: bky6_GQhaSt

## Step 4: Slim the base image

The Pexlor gateway now builds from a distroless base, removing the shell and package manager flagged in last quarter's review. All debugging utilities were moved to a separate sidecar image that is never deployed to production. The runtime settings the slimmed image expects are listed below.

settings of fafog-haduf:
ZORIX_PIN=4648
ZORIX_METRICS_HOST=metrics.zorix.paliqsys.corp
ZORIX_LOG_LEVEL=info
ZORIX_TENANT=druix